Market Dynamics: Solar + Storage Synergy
Ireland’s 2030 target – 80% renewable electricity – drives demand for photovoltaic systems with integrated storage. The levelized cost of storage (LCOS) for lithium-ion batteries has dropped 40% since 2018, making projects financially viable.
| Metric | 2021 | 2023 |
|---|---|---|
| Installed PV Capacity | 92 MW | 215 MW |
| Operational Storage Projects | 3 | 11 |
| Average Project Size | 8 MWh | 22 MWh |
Innovation Spotlight: Virtual Power Plants
Several Irish operators now aggregate distributed storage systems into virtual power plants (VPPs). This approach helps balance regional grids – imagine dozens of small batteries dancing in sync to match supply and demand.
Implementation Challenges and Solutions
- Grid Congestion: 67% of new projects require upgraded connections
- Revenue Stacking: Successful operators combine frequency regulation with capacity market income
- Cycling Stability: New LiFePO4 batteries achieve 6,000+ cycles at 90% depth of discharge
